National Newspaper Week coming Oct. 6-12

The theme for this year’s National Newspaper Week, Oct. 6-12, is “Think F1rst — Know Your 5 Freedoms” and encourages readers to cherish all of the guarantees of the First Amendment.

Nevada newspapers will find several ideas for localizing their Newspaper Week efforts at this site hosted by Newspaper Association Managers. There is no cost to NPA members for the resources, including the 2019 logo, editorial cartoons, opinion columns and an ad campaign (in various sizes) emphasizing those First Amendment freedoms.

“Please also make it local by editorializing about your newspaper’s unique relevance. This can be about your duties as government watchdog, your role as a community forum and coverage of community events, publication of timely public notices, etc.,” said Mark Maassen, executive director of the Missouri Press Association and chairman of this year’s campaign.

The ad campaign is designed to run beyond Newspaper Week and continue throughout the year, if desired. Papers can apply their own flags to the ads.

“Thank you for supporting National Newspaper Week,” added Maassen. “You already know there is power in association. And the same principle holds when associations like ours band together to provide even greater impact — both directly to newspaper members locally and collectively to the overall industry nationwide.

National Newspaper Week is now in its 79th year.
